Output d88c83def7492ec7fb083adee1b7ea638046a70113617c2581e83e90859e6f87:0

value
6076811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24c49f618cb93d61fe06e1f1ccd8ef4b653617b7 OP_EQUAL
address
MBFa6utF1HYJjjJFweNbogAhnPqgUcjE6s
transaction
d88c83def7492ec7fb083adee1b7ea638046a70113617c2581e83e90859e6f87
spent
true